Jagdalpur : An 11-day All India Football Competition 2024 has been organised from November 7 to November 17 , 2024 at the local Priyadarshini Stadium Jagdalpur under the aegis of Bastar District Football Association in Gadalpur Bastar Division Headquarters Jagdalpur, which was inaugurated on Thursday October 7 , 2024 . Giving information about this, Dilip Das, Secretary of Bastar District Football Association said that the inaugural ceremony took place in the presence of Chief Guest Lata Usendi, National Vice President BJP, Mahesh Kashyap MP Bastar, Special Guest Mayor Safira Sahu, District Football Association President Rana Ghosh and senior players.
The opening match of the competition was played between SC Kotpad Odisha and DFA Kodagaon, in which Kotpad won the match by 3-2, two matches will be played on today Friday November 8 , 2024 -1 pm, the first match will be played between Ramakrishna Mission Narayanpur and DFA Dantewada and the second match will be played between DFA Jagdalpur and War Hawks Narharpur, the guests praised the District Football Association for organising this competition and congratulated and wished them and said that the District Football Association deserves congratulations for starting this competition after a long time of about 9 years.
The final match will be held on Sunday November 17 , 2024 in this All India Football Competition, 17 teams from 10 states across the country including Telangana, Kerala, West Bengal, Jharkhand, Odisha, Andhra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h, Tamil Nadu, Maharashtra and Chhattisgarh have participated.

Let us inform you that this competition is being organised after almost 09 years in Jagdalpur, the headquarters of Bastar division, about which there is a lot of enthusiasm among sports lovers. People said that national level players will also gather in this Maha Kumbh of football, sports lovers will get to see excellent games. In the competition, the winning team will be given one lakh one thousand rupees and the runner-up will be given a cash prize of 51 thousand rupees and a trophy.
